This weekend I too the time to disassemble my mono gear which had been
assembled a few years ago. I took some measurements.

Using feeler gauges, one Port swing arm was .055" away from seating when the
Starboard leg was against the stop.  Doing the Trig, after grinding this
down to equal seating, this provided .8 degree improvement in Over Center
condition.

Allowing for the taper of approximately 4 degrees in the swing arm,
measuring with a balance protractor against the arm and then the shock
absorber - hanging straight down, the over center condition is now 2.31
degrees.  I have not measured yet with the gear reattached, but assume this
will improve slightly.

The corollary of the above is that the original position before grinding was
1.51 degrees.  This is virtually nothing.

Studying the design, if the shock absorbers were not dampening well in the
reverse direction, a smack of the wheel against the ground and bounce up,
would allow the rubber block to snap the gear down quickly, and pop out the
over center of 1.5 degrees if there were any slop or bending in the gear
retraction lever.  This is particularly worrisome, as how does one check the
performance of the shocks - pull down on the prop in the same way you check
a tri-gear's oleo?   I know it's working for a lot of people, and has the
blessing of the PFA, but it sure seems marginal.

I am considering locking the gear down, (which will also improve
insurability) which is easily done in a variety of ways.  Fairing this in
would be fairly easy with a large shapely fibreglass cover.  I would then
operate the flaps and outriggers separately.  Has anyone done this?

I guess no one knows what the speed penalty is if the gear is left down in
cruise! (Unless you cruise around with the flaps down all the time!)
